Proposed Name: Lakeside
“Lakeside” highlights one of the most defining shared features of Huntsville, Eden, and Liberty — their connection to Pineview Reservoir. The name instantly evokes images of beaches, boating, fishing, paddleboarding, and quiet mountain water views. It puts lifestyle at the forefront, suggesting a community built around recreation, relaxation, and scenic outdoor living on the water’s edge.
The name is simple and easy to understand, but it may need clarification because many towns across the U.S. use the word “Lakeside.” To differentiate it, branding would need to emphasize the unique character of this valley, including its three ski resorts, mountain setting, rural roots, and year-round activities beyond the reservoir. With the right messaging, “Lakeside” could feel both inviting and accurate as a representation of the area’s everyday life and outdoor appeal.
Pros
• Clearly connected to Pineview Reservoir, a key local feature
• Simple, inviting, and easy for visitors to understand
• Works well for tourism, rentals, and outdoor lifestyle branding
• Neutral and doesn’t favor Huntsville, Eden, or Liberty
• Reflects a relaxing, nature-focused community identity
Cons
• Many U.S. communities use the name “Lakeside,” reducing uniqueness
• Doesn’t reference mountains or ski culture directly
• Could overemphasize the reservoir over other aspects of the valley
• Would require branding to avoid confusion with other Lakeside towns
